SAN JOSÉ, Costa Rica — It has been 42 years since the United Fruit Company departed Costa Rica, but communities in the Southern Zone are actively shifting from banana monoculture toward a sustainable, biodiversity-led tourism model.

A Shift in Mindset Built on Education

Community leaders have spearheaded local initiatives to protect mangroves, rivers, and wildlife, turning natural conservation into a viable economic engine for former agricultural towns.

“The region educated itself to manage tourism out of nothing. By taking children out of schools and leading them to clean the mangroves… people learned to play a good role.”

— Jorge Uribe, Founder of La Perla del Sur

From Informality to Regional Growth

What started as informal local tours along the Sierpe River and Golfo Dulce has matured as government regulations pushed boat operators toward formal business practices. Today, tourism benefits local tour guides, restaurants, and hospitality services alike.

Ongoing Infrastructure and Access Challenges

  • Infrastructure: Limited hotel capacity near key areas like Sierpe.
  • Accessibility: Transit times of several hours from main airports hinder rapid growth.
  • Digitalization: Local enterprises require better online visibility to attract international travelers.
